JS存取cookie

/**
*设置Cookie
*@key Cookie名称
*@value Cookie值
*@expiredays Cookie有效时间
*/
function setCookie(key, value, expiredays){
	var date = new Date();
	date.setDate(date.getDate() + expiredays);
	document.cookie = key+ "=" + escape(value) + ((expiredays==null) ? "" : ";expires="+date.toGMTString())+";path=/;domain=.js.10086.cn";
}

/**
*根据key值获取Cookie
*@key Cookie名称
*/
function getCookie(key){
	if ( document.cookie.length > 0 )
	{
		c_start = document.cookie.indexOf(key + "=");
		if ( c_start != -1 )
		{
			c_start = c_start + key.length + 1;
			c_end = document.cookie.indexOf(";",c_start);
			if ( c_end == -1 )
			{
				c_end=document.cookie.length;
			}
			return unescape(document.cookie.substring(c_start,c_end));
		} 
	}
	return "";
}

 

你可能感兴趣的:(JS存取cookie)